Q1 Earnings, Auto Sales Data, and Fed Policy to Influence Market Sentiment

Indian markets faced their longest weekly decline of 2025, with the NIFTY and SENSEX closing down for the fourth consecutive week. Factors such as foreign fund outflows, mixed corporate earnings, and uncertainties over the India-U.S. trade deal contributed to the downturn. The NIFTY ended at 24,837, down 0.3%, while the SENSEX settled at 81,463, also down 0.3%.

Housing Sales Surge 7% in 2024, Reaching 12-Year High at 3.5 Lakh Units Across Top 8 Cities

Housing sales in India's top eight cities saw a 7% annual increase in 2024, reaching a 12-year high of 3,50,613 units. This growth was driven by a strong demand for premium homes priced between Rs 2-5 crore, according to property consultant Knight Frank.
